KfW mandates as ESM romps home
The European Stability Mechanism made a benchmark debut on Tuesday with a five year that came at the upper end of size expectations. Pricing offered a decent premium over where the borrower is expected to trade in relation to its peers, helping to produce a deal that was more than twice subscribed in just 45 minutes. KfW is set to follow with a benchmark in the same maturity.
